This is Asus’ Eee Keyboard. This isn’t some run-of-the-mill keyboard, this will be a fully functioning computer housed in the body of a keyboard, the Eee Keyboard. On the right side, there is a five inch touch screen display/touchpad.
Asus would like its Keyboard to travel around the house and wirelessly hook up with televisions and displays via ultra wideband. Asus calls this the “First Wireless Media Center Enabled by Ultra Wideband HDMI.”
I think they’re right because I don’t think I’ve ever seen a product like this. While I have seen computers built into the keyboard, this is different.
When can you expect to see this product? I was given two answers. One Asus representative told me that this product had no release date, but this displayed device was a prototype. Another Asus rep told me to expect the Eee Keyboard this year. Which person was right? We’ll find out.
